What does an assistant graphics designer do in the federal government?

An Assistant Graphics Designer in the federal government supports the creation and production of visual materials for official documents, presentations, and digital content. Their work includes designing layouts, editing images, and ensuring graphics comply with agency branding and accessibility standards. They often collaborate with communications teams, follow federal guidelines, and use design software like Adobe Creative Suite. This role is essential for ensuring that government information is visually clear, professional, and accessible to the public.

What are the typical collaborative projects an assistant graphics designer works on in the federal government?

As an Assistant Graphics Designer in the federal government, you will frequently collaborate with communications teams, project managers, and subject matter experts to create visual content for official publications, reports, presentations, and digital campaigns. Projects often require working within established branding guidelines and may involve tight deadlines, especially for high-profile initiatives. The role provides opportunities to contribute creative ideas while supporting the agency’s mission, and teamwork is essential for ensuring that all visual materials align with overall communication goals.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an assistant graphics designer in the federal government,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Assistant Graphics Designer in the Federal Government, you need a solid understanding of design principles, proficiency in graphic design, and typically a relevant degree or certification. Familiarity with industry-standard software like Adobe Creative Suite (Photoshop, Illustrator, InDesign) and knowledge of government branding guidelines are essential. Attention to detail, strong communication, and the ability to work collaboratively within a team set standout professionals apart. These skills and qualities ensure that visual materials meet government standards, effectively communicate information, and support the organization’s mission.

Job Summary

The Senior Digital Marketing Strategist is responsible for creating and managing integrated organic and paid media campaigns across multiple digital marketing channels including search engines, social media platforms and web. This role combines strategic campaign planning with hands-on content creation and cross-channel execution. The ideal candidate will develop compelling campaign content that aligns with market and business priorities; collaborate closely with Graphic Design, Digital Marketing and internal stakeholders to develop campaign visuals and measure campaign success; manage campaign refreshes to maintain relevance; and drive consistent brand voice across all marketing touchpoints. This position requires staying current with campaign best practices, AI search trends and integrating digital strategies with the overall marketing plan to drive measurable results.

  • Develop integrated organic and paid campaign strategies across Google Ads, Microsoft Advertising (Bing), LinkedIn and other relevant digital platforms.
  • Lead campaign creation and management, including the development of ad copy, messaging frameworks and campaign themes that align with business development objectives and market sector priorities.
  • Collaborate with the Graphic Design team to develop campaign visuals, ensuring creative assets align with campaign messaging and brand guidelines.
  • Manage campaign refreshes and optimization cycles to keep content current, maintain engagement and improve performance across all channels.
  • Coordinate cross-channel campaign launches, ensuring consistent brand voice and messaging across search, social media, email, display and other digital touchpoints.
  • Align campaign content and strategy with market trends, competitive landscape and business priorities through regular consultation with internal stakeholders.
  • Collaborate with the Digital Marketing team to monitor and optimize campaign performance using Google Analytics, platform-specific analytics and other marketing tools to meet ROI objectives.
  • Stay current with digital marketing best practices, platform updates, algorithm changes and emerging trends in paid and organic campaign management.
  • Conduct A/B testing on campaign content, ad creative, landing pages and targeting strategies to continuously improve performance.
